This commit is contained in:
parent
f8de8543ab
commit
139bed3da0
|
|
@ -16,6 +16,7 @@
|
|||
:option="option"
|
||||
@on-load="onLoad"
|
||||
@refresh-change="onLoad"
|
||||
@search-reset="handleResetSearch"
|
||||
@current-change="handleCurrentChange"
|
||||
@size-change="handleSizeChange"
|
||||
@search-change="handleSearch"
|
||||
|
|
@ -166,6 +167,13 @@ const onLoad = async (pageParam = page) => {
|
|||
}
|
||||
};
|
||||
|
||||
const handleResetSearch = (done) => {
|
||||
searchParams.value = {}; // 清空搜索条件
|
||||
page.currentPage = 1; // 重置到第一页
|
||||
onLoad(); // 重新加载数据
|
||||
done && done(); // 通知 Avue 搜索已完成(可选)
|
||||
};
|
||||
|
||||
// 查询方法
|
||||
const handleSearch = (params, done) => {
|
||||
// 保存搜索参数
|
||||
|
|
|
|||
Loading…
Reference in New Issue